Graduation Requirements

Before you start dreaming about college life, make sure you meet all the graduation requirements. Check your transcript regularly to ensure you are on track.

  • Required Courses: Confirm you have completed all necessary core courses (Math, Science, English, Social Studies). Specific requirements may vary, so consult your counselor or the school's official website for a complete list.
  • Credits: Know exactly how many credits you need to graduate. Any missing credits should be addressed early in the year.
  • GPA: Your GPA is important for college applications and scholarships. Focus on maintaining or improving your grades throughout the semester.
  • Electives: Use your electives to explore your interests or strengthen your college applications.

College Applications & Financial Aid

Applying to college is a major undertaking. Start early!

  • Application Deadlines: Track application deadlines meticulously. Many schools have early action or early decision deadlines. Missing them could mean missing out on your preferred college.
  • Standardized Tests: Check which colleges require the SAT or ACT, and register for the tests well in advance. Many colleges are test-optional now, but check each school's policy.
  • Letters of Recommendation: Request letters of recommendation from teachers and counselors who know you well. Give them ample time to write strong recommendations.
  • Essays: College essays are crucial. Start brainstorming early and allow plenty of time for revisions.
  • Financial Aid & Scholarships: Explore all financial aid options, including federal grants, scholarships, and loans. Start researching and applying for scholarships early in the year. Staying Organized

The key to a successful senior year is staying organized.

  • Planner: Use a planner or calendar to keep track of deadlines, appointments, and events.
  • Counselor Meetings: Schedule regular meetings with your school counselor to discuss your progress and college plans.
  • To-Do Lists: Create to-do lists to manage tasks and stay on top of your workload.
